Output 64901a30cbc7c2f0799191752949b40153027015ddebec3638aad2a0126aab5e:0

value
27989687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d9b993ee7aa461ea04a5cf8995d36761fba0024 OP_EQUALVERIFY OP_CHECKSIG
address
1CT9sAHrSWqbjEwtJLPjZXFi23wK8NYmBr
transaction
64901a30cbc7c2f0799191752949b40153027015ddebec3638aad2a0126aab5e
spent
true